With limitations, movie theaters reopen, except those in NYC

Starting next Friday, movie theaters across the state, with the exception of those in New York City, will finally be able to reopen at limited capacity.

Governor Cuomo authorized these businesses to reopen at 25% capacity and will gradually reach a maximum of 50% per projection.

The use of the masks is mandatory all the time but it is allowed to remove it momentarily to consume food or drinks.

Movie theaters will also assign the location of participants to ensure social distancing.

This decision comes after months of criticism of the limitations Cuomo has imposed on film companies and entertainment groups.
